Assessing Your Yard and Preparation the Layout
When you're ready to mount a sprinkler system, the first action is evaluating your yard and preparing the format. Take note of sun exposure and any kind of shaded spots, as these factors influence water demands.
Next, take into consideration the water stress readily available to you. Test it making use of a simple stress gauge to validate your system can operate effectively. Strategy the placement of lawn sprinkler heads based upon protection; you'll want them to overlap slightly to avoid completely dry spots.
Lay out a harsh format, marking the areas of the primary lines and sprinkler heads. Believe about the kinds of sprinklers you'll make use of and their reach. Preparation meticulously now will make your installation easier and verify your plants get the correct amount of water.

Identifying Trench Depth
Establishing the appropriate trench depth is important for ensuring your sprinkler system works properly. Normally, you'll intend to dig trenches about 6 to 12 inches deep, depending upon your neighborhood environment and the sort of pipelines you're using. Much deeper trenches help avoid pipes from freezing if you live in an area with freezing temperature levels. Make certain to take into consideration the dimension of your pipes; bigger pipes may need much deeper trenches for correct setup. In addition, examine local codes or guidelines, as they may determine certain depth requirements. As you dig, keep the trench width workable-- around 12 inches is usually sufficient. By doing this, you can conveniently install and access the pipes when needed, guaranteeing your system runs smoothly.

Setting Up Sprinkler People and Valves
Setting up sprinkler heads and shutoffs is a vital action in creating a reliable irrigation system for your lawn or yard (Cheap sprinkler repair). Begin by placing the lawn sprinkler heads at the marked areas, making certain they're equally spaced for optimal coverage. Dig a tiny opening for each head, validating it's deep enough for correct setup
Following, attach the lawn sprinkler heads to the pipes, protecting them tightly to stop leaks. Usage Teflon tape on the threads for added assurance.
When it involves valves, pick a location quickly accessible for maintenance. Mount the valves according to the supplier's instructions, attaching them to the mainline pipes. Make certain they're level and safe, as this will assist with regular water flow.
Finally, test each sprinkler head and shutoff for proper function prior to burying any kind of pipes. This step warranties your system operates efficiently and efficiently, supplying the most effective take care of your plants.
Attaching the Main Water Supply
With the lawn sprinkler heads and valves safely in place, you'll now link the major water to your irrigation system. Begin by finding the major water line, usually near your home's foundation. Shut down the supply of water to protect against any kind of leaks or spills during the process. Next off, make use of a pipe cutter to produce a tidy cut in the major line, ensuring it's the appropriate size for your fittings. Set up a T-fitting to draw away water into your sprinkler system. Make certain it's tightly secured, and use Teflon tape on the threads for a watertight seal. After that, attach the PVC pipeline resulting in your lawn sprinkler system to the T-fitting. Confirm all connections are leak-free and tight. Once whatever's in place, turn the water supply back on gradually, looking for any kind of leakages at the joints. This step is necessary for a smooth procedure of your lawn sprinkler.

Regularly Asked Inquiries
Just how Lengthy Does It Normally Require To Set Up a Lawn Sprinkler?
Generally, setting up a lawn sprinkler takes anywhere from one to 3 days, relying on your backyard's dimension and complexity. You'll intend to prepare for added time if you're doing it on your own or working with help.
Can I Mount a Lawn Sprinkler System During Winter?
You can mount a sprinkler system throughout wintertime, however it's challenging. Cold temperature levels can freeze pipelines, making setup difficult. Make certain you're prepared for potential issues and protect your tools properly. if you pick to proceed.
What Is the Ordinary Cost of a New Automatic Sprinkler?
The average expense of a brand-new automatic sprinkler commonly ranges in between $2,000 and $4,000, depending on your lawn dimension and system complexity. You'll intend to obtain several quotes to locate the most effective choice for you.
Exist Eco-Friendly Options for Sprinkler Equipments?
Yes, there are environment-friendly alternatives for automatic sprinkler. You can select drip watering, rain sensors, or wise controllers that maximize water usage and minimize waste, aiding you maintain a lush garden while being eco conscious.
How Commonly Should I Keep My Automatic Sprinkler?
As soon as in springtime and once in fall,You ought to preserve your lawn sprinkler system at the very least two times a year--. Normal checks help guarantee efficiency, avoid leakages, and maintain your yard healthy and balanced, conserving you time and cash in the future.
